Looking at Goose Green Primary and Nursery School, you will see a happy place. It is a focussed and purposeful learning environment. The school has been open since September 1, 2017. It emerged from a fresh start. Before that, it was Goose Green Primary School.
Miss Louise Partridge and Mrs. Cat Shuttleworth are headteachers here. They guide the school with passion. The school provides nursery classes. It caters to children aged 3 to 11. Goose Green Primary and Nursery School has a capacity for 450 pupils. Currently, 256 pupils attend.
Goose Green sits in the urban heart of London. Specifically, it is in the Southwark district. The school’s location is Tintagel Crescent, East Dulwich. It falls within the Goose Green ward.
In January 2020, Ofsted rated Goose Green as “Good”. This rating covered several areas. These were quality of education and behaviour. Personal development and leadership were also praised. Early years provision was also rated as good.
Approximately 44.1% of pupils are eligible for free school meals. This shows the school’s commitment to inclusivity. Goose Green welcomes children from all backgrounds.
